Transaction 353a3684e12bbbf41011193258207d4590d0e155b6e7adfa0e566ff8a6c229c8
1 Input
1 Output
-
353a3684e12bbbf41011193258207d4590d0e155b6e7adfa0e566ff8a6c229c8:0
- value
- 10295425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fc4c552efc77bbff6b399a748337c531ae4fb26 OP_EQUAL
- address
- 3EoCGrG9XeiwtmUkB7Fct81Grjoddozjgv